Typical teaching shifts are weekdays 2:00-9:00 pm and Saturdays between 2:30-8:00 pm. Specific shifts will be determined based on studio needs and teacher availability. Must be comfortable teaching all ages, levels, and genres. Must be comfortable with pop, musical theatre, and classical styles. Teacher must be able to teach up to advanced voice and beginner to intermediate piano. Stellar interpersonal skills are a must! Bachelor's Degree in Music required. Many students are beginners who do not read sheet music. Some students work on originals, and some students work with chords/lead sheets if we can not find piano/vocal arrangements. Above all, flexibility and an ability to improvise to accommodate students' individual needs is key. Bachelor's in Music Required, Master's Preferred Excellent communication skills Outgoing personality Minimum 1 year prior experience Knowledge of contemporary & traditional styles w/ strong reading skills Ability to teach beginner to advanced students Excellent musical and professional references This is a part-time position with up to 8-20 hours a week depending on need and availability throughout the year.
